A meat processing company in Brighton is seeking skilled or semi-skilled Boning Hall Operatives for its Shrewsbury site. This role requires flexibility, working hours from 6:30 am, and the ability to carry out tasks in a fast-paced food production environment. The ideal candidates should have prior butchery experience or a willingness to learn knife skills. Responsibilities include ensuring quality and safety in meat preparation. Competitive compensation is offered.

How to prepare for a job interview at ABP UK Shrewsbury

Know Your Cuts

Familiarise yourself with different cuts of meat and their uses. Being able to discuss your knowledge of butchery during the interview will show your passion for the role and your understanding of the industry.

Show Your Flexibility

Since the job requires flexibility in working hours, be prepared to discuss your availability. Highlight any previous experience where you adapted to changing schedules or worked in fast-paced environments.

Safety First

Understand the importance of safety and hygiene in meat preparation. Be ready to talk about any relevant practices you’ve followed in past roles, as this will demonstrate your commitment to quality and safety standards.

Ask Questions

Prepare thoughtful questions about the company’s processes and culture. This not only shows your interest in the position but also helps you gauge if it’s the right fit for you.
